How do I use Google Earth in AutoCAD?
Here are the steps:
- Step 1: Open Google Earth and create a placemark, path or polygon, or simply load an existing KML/KMZ file.
- Step 2: Right-click on the polygon, and select “Copy”
- Step 3: Open your AutoCAD drawing, right-click and select “Clipboard” → Paste, or simply press Ctrl-V.

Can I import a KMZ file into AutoCAD?
There is no built-in option to bring in KML/KMZ data. You might therefore look for online tools that allow for converting from KML/KMZ to SHP. You can also search in Autodesk APP Store for third party plug-ins.
How do I import an aerial into AutoCAD?
Use one of the following two processes to import the aerial images from the saved locations….With AutoCAD Technology:
- Type in MAPIINSERT on the command line, and hit enter.
- Navigate to the file or folder where the images are saved, and open them.
- Review or change the settings and click Apply.
How do I convert AutoCAD to KML?
To Export To KML (Keyhole Markup Language)
- At the command line, enter MAPEXPORT and press .
- In the Export Location dialog box, select the Google KML file format and a location for the exported files.
- In the Export dialog box, specify how to export objects.
- On the Selection tab, specify the objects to export.

What can I use with Google Earth and AutoCAD?
Looking to take advantage of Google Earth in AutoCAD? Available on the Autodesk App Store, CAD-Earth “is designed to easily import and export images, objects, and terrain meshes between Google Earth and AutoCAD,” as well as create dynamic contour lines and profiles.

How to integrate Google Maps and OpenStreetMaps in AutoCAD?
To integrate Google Maps, OpenStreetMaps, … in AutoCAD we use Spatial Manager for AutoCAD. It allows us to establish dynamic background maps in AutoCAD that is updated as we make view changes and captures can be made to embed them in the DWGs (as an external image or as an OLE object).
